Highlights
Are people in Centennial older or younger than people in Berkley?
- The Median Age in Centennial is 7.8 years older than in Berkley.

Are housing costs cheaper in Centennial or Berkley?
- Centennial housing costs are 29.5% more expensive than Berkley hous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Centennial or Berkley?
- The average commute for residents of Centennial is 1.1 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Berkley.
